In 1870, Katherine “Kittie” Knapp entered the world in Cedar Falls, Black Hawk, Iowa, USA, born to Marquis Lafayette Knapp And Mary Amanda Wells. Katherine “Kittie” Knapp passed away in 1940 in St Louis, Missouri, USA.
